2014—2016年辽宁省蟑螂监测分析 被引量:6

Surveillance on cockroaches in Liaoning Province from 2014 to 2016

摘要 目的掌握辽宁省蟑螂密度、侵害率、季节消长和种类构成等情况,为科学开展蟑螂防控提供依据。方法采用粘捕法在居民区、宾馆、餐饮、医院、农贸市场等5种类型城市监测点进行蟑螂监测。结果 2014-2016年共捕获蟑螂30 455只,德国小蠊占96.98%,为主要优势种群。总密度为0.52只/张,总侵害率为11.87%。不同生境蟑螂密度和侵害率都以农贸市场最高,宾馆最低。蟑螂密度季节消长变化趋势2014年和2015年呈单峰曲线,2016年呈多峰曲线;蟑螂侵害率季节消长变化趋势各年均呈单峰曲线,侵害率的最高峰都分布在7-8月。结论 2014-2016年蟑螂密度呈小幅上升趋势。蟑螂密度季节消长变化趋势2014年和2015年呈单峰曲线,而各年侵害率季节消长变化趋势都呈单峰曲线。农贸市场应作为蟑螂防控工作的重点,结合不同生境蟑螂密度和侵害率的季节消长趋势,在高峰期采取综合防控措施,以达到降低蟑螂密度和控制疾病的目的。 Objective To master the condition of cockroach density,infestation situation,seasonal variation and population distribution,and provide a basis for developing cockroach control strategies.Methods Stick traps method was employed for monitoring cockroaches.In town,monitoring points were set up in five types of environment,including residential areas,hotels,restaurants,hospitals and farm product markets.Results A total of 30 455 cockroaches were captured from 2014 to 2016.The dominant species was Blattella germanica(97.15%).The total density was 0.52 insects per sheet and the total disoperation rate was 12.89%.The highest cockroach density and disoperation appeared in farm product markets,the lowest in hotels.Seasonal variations of cockroach density in 2014 and 2015 showed a single peak curve,but the trend in 2016 showed a double peak curve.The cockroach disoperation rate showed a single peak curve over the years.The highest peaks of density and disoperation rate occurred either in July or August.Conclusion The density of cockroach showed a slight rise from 2014 to 2016.Seasonal variations of cockroach density in 2014 and 2015 showed a single peak curve.The cockroach disoperation rate showed a single curve over the years.The farm product market should be the focus of the cockroach prevention and control.Combined with the seasonal fluctuation trend of cockroach density and disoperation rate in different habitats,comprehensive prevention should be taken during the active peak to reduce cockroach density and control diseases.
